Blurb

Sunny's life is turned upside down when she finds out she isn't who she thought she was. She dreams of a place that she thought didn't exist, until she gets taken to participate to be the wife of the prince of the fire realm. Will she uncover the truth to who she really is? Or will the secrets uncover more secrets? Will she ever find Luna, or is she infact the long lost love of the prince that was thought to be dead.
